Chapter 33. Cadence

CADENCE

"I told you I'm not interested in your company, dad. Let Colin handle all of that," I complained as soon as I saw my dad waiting for me.

He suddenly told me that he was going to visit me, and I already knew what he wanted from me. I don't even want to go back to that city; I want to stay here in Paris and study multimedia arts until I graduate.

I got in the van, and he followed.

"Your brother is going to get married in three days," he said, and I was so surprised to hear that. Since when did my brother even date a person?

"So you're just here to pick me up for the wedding?" I asked as I rested my head on the window.

"And I need you to handle the company."

Here we go again.

"Look, I'm not really interested in your business. Dad, I don't even know how to speak simple business talk like you," I complained even more.
